2014sman Users1
2014sman Users1
(SMAN)
User’s Manual
Silvaco, Inc.
4701 Patrick Henry Drive, Bldg. 2 January 8, 2014
Santa Clara, CA 95054
Phone (408) 567-1000
Web www.silvaco.com
Notice
Style Conventions
Chapter 1
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6
1.1 What is the Silvaco Management Console .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7
1.2 The SMAN Window .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8
1.2.1 Running SMAN in Windows .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8
1.2.2 Running SMAN in UNIX/Linux .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8
Chapter 2
Actions.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9
2.1 About Screen.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 10
2.2 Documents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 11
2.3 Products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 14
2.3.1 Analog & Mixed Signal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 15
2.3.2 Custom IC CAD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16
2.3.3 Digital CAD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 17
2.3.4 Interconnect Modeling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 18
2.3.5 TCAD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 19
2.3.6 Add and Manage Updates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 20
2.3.7 All Applications .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21
2.4 System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
2.4.1 System Information .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
2.4.2 Communications Information .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 23
2.4.3 Environment Information .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24
2.4.4 File Checksums .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25
2.4.5 Licensing Information .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26
2.4.6 Manage Encryption Keys .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28
2.4.7 Processes Information .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 29
2.4.8 System Diagnostics Screen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 30
Chapter 3
Preferences .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 31
Chapter 4
Reports .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 33
4.1 Generating a Report .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 34
Appendix A
Installing Updates .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 36
A.1 Updating Silvaco Products .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 37
A.1.1 Step 1: Start the Silvaco Management Console (SMAN). .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 37
A.1.2 Step 2: Select the Add and Manage Updates button () from the toolbar or from the Tools menu. . . . 37
A.1.3 Step 3: The Updates Installed window lists all installed baselines and updates. . . . . . . . . . . . . . . . . . 37
A.1.4 Step 4: Click on the Browse button and select the update (.ssu) or baseline (.exe, .tar.gz, .tgz) file
to install.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 38
Appendix C
Hourly Charge Clock .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 44
C.1 SFLM Hourly Charges .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 45
Appendix D
Encrypting a File .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 46
D.1 Encrypt File.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 47
PDK documents (Figure 2-5) are documents that contain the description and release notes of
the PDK collections installed.
From the SMAN product, you can also manage the licensing server. On Windows, this is
done through the SMAN product itself (see Figure 2-19). On UNIX machines, SMAN asks
you to enter the name of the web browser to use to manage SFLM.
The Preferences dialog allows you to set preferences, such as how to extract updates, when to
warn on hourly charges, setting internet settings, configuration of toolbars, and shortcuts.
A.1.2 Step 2: Select the Add and Manage Updates button ( ) from the toolbar or
from the Tools menu.
A.1.3 Step 3: The Updates Installed window lists all installed baselines and updates.
A.1.4 Step 4: Click on the Browse button and select the update (.ssu) or baseline
(.exe, .tar.gz, .tgz) file to install.
A.1.6 Step 6: The update or baseline will be installed and any installation output will
be displayed in the Output window.
A.1.7 Step 7: A copy of all baseline and update files will be placed in the
$Silvaco\updates directory (where $Silvaco is the installation directory
for Silvaco products).
On Linux, SMAN will create a desktop folder. This will contain the shortcuts of each product.
This folder is created under the home directories $HOME/Desktop and $HOME/.gnome-
desktop to take into account the KDE and GNOME desktops. See Figure B-2.
Type Of Encryption
This option allows you to specify whether to use Line by Line or Entire File encryption.
Line by Line encryption will encrypt each line (ending in a newline character), which is
useful for ASCII files. This adds the –at command line argument to Sencrypt.
Entire File encryption is used to encrypt binary files and will encrypt the entire file.
Use Key
This option allows you to pick one or more keys to be applied to the file when encrypting.
This adds a –skey=<key> to the command line arguments to Sencrypt for each <key>
selected.
TCAD Input Deck
This option must be used if the file that is being encrypted is a TCAD input deck that is to be
processed by DeckBuild. This is so that DeckBuild can decrypt the file to be set to its associ-
ated programs. This adds the –deckbuild command line argument to Sencrypt.
Encrypt Blocks
This option allows you to specify which part of an ASCII file may be encrypted. This adds the
–protect command line argument to Sencrypt.
Include Maintenance protection
This option allows you to only allow other users to use this file if their license is valid at the
time of encryption. This adds the –mtime command line argument to Sencrypt.
Backup Original
This option informs SMAN to make a copy of the original file to be encrypted. This is useful
if you want to encrypt (and use) the file immediately. This option is on by default as there is
no decryption tool.